I may be making assumptions, but here's what I can say: -Watching streams and copying pros is stupid. This does not help you improve. -Getting frustrated about losing is stupid. Just play the best you can and you will win some and lose some. The less you pay attention to numbers the less likely you are to make calm decisions instead of tilting hard. -Counter picking well takes lots of experience and a large pool of champs you are good at. Keep doing it. -Become a better player =/= climbing ranks. Sometimes matchmaking fucks you over. The more you play the more likely you are to be placed wherever you belong. -Play champs that are the most fun for you, not the most op champs. If these coincide though, of course that's great. Play champs you have experience with and really understand, not pick someone strong and follow basic build or whatever you saw on some stream. -Taking monthlong breaks is obviously not going to help you improve. But neither is playing too much. Personally, I get my daily win and then play something else most days but however you space it is up to you. Point is, taking long breaks for whatever reason doesn't really do anything for you.

Things you can probably do to improve: -Focus on objectives over kills. -Map awareness. -Play champs you have the most experience with and understand best. -Coordinate with team. Discuss plans etc.
